i don't see the big deal with the XM bulbs i really don't like the color |
I agree, but you also have to take into account the camera. If this was film each type of film has different sensitivities to the colour spectrum. If it was digital every cameras' CCD will see light differently then you have the camera's software that will always adjust colour to some degree (input profile). But over all I think this is the best colour comparison on the web. I believe this was shot for RC.

The only problem I have with that test is that it was done using the standard PFO ballast. while it is the most commen ballast, it is not the one 3 of thoes bulbs were originaly intended to run on and in fact a 250 radium won't even run off a standard PFO ballast unless you order an aditional starter.
a second note as I compare the PAR values on that page with the ones posted by JB they are all wrong so who ever did this page used the photos and it seam they made up values :neutral: Steve |
